PREVIEW: Knights look to stay hot against Redeemer

After a commanding 3-0 victory over the Lambton Lions (0-5, 6th OCAA West), the Niagara Knights men's soccer program  (3-1, 2nd OCAA West) look to extend their winning streak to four games as they head into Ancaster Tuesday night to face off against the Redeemer Royals (1-2-1, 5th OCAA West).

Tuesday's game looks to be a special one, as third year striker Carlos Williams (St. Catharines, Ont.) enters the game with the opportunity to move past former Knights superstar Matt Miedema for the all-time goal scoring lead. Williams and Miedema are currently tied for the title with an impressive 10 goals.

This is a crucial game for the Knights, who currently sit 4 points behind the OCAA west division leading Fanshawe Falcons with one game in hand. With a win in Tuesday night's matchup, the Knights will sit just one point behind the Falcons.

The game between the Knights and Royals is located on the North Field at the Redeemer college campus on Tuesday, September 26th. Kickoff is at 8pm.
